Why Should I Get Dental Implants?

81283800Losing a tooth, or a few teeth, may not just seem like an aesthetic issue initially, it can pose some very serious problems in the long-term if not treated. Your jawbone requires stimulation from your teeth throughout the day. The stimulation helps with the health and growth of the bone. Your teeth, through the thousands of contacts received throughout the day from chewing and colliding into each other, provide the stimulation for your jaw. If a tooth is missing, there is a small lack of that stimulation. Over time, that area in the jawbone will begin to lose mass, meaning height and width will decrease. Dental implants can not only replace the missing tooth, but also provide the stimulation necessary.

What is the Procedure?

Dr. Paul Davey, a top-tier practitioner with years of experience, and his crack team of experts are prepared to give you the smile you deserve. When you come in for your first appointment, we will examine, map out, and plan your replacement tooth. After everything is set, we will put you under with anesthesia and surgically implant a titanium biocompatible post in the missing area. A healing period is necessary after the surgery, but after it has healed, we will bring you back in to cement and bond the replacement tooth to the post. The tooth is strong, looks natural, and functions just like your normal teeth.

How Does Periodontal Disease Develop?

In a word, plaque. Plaque is a sticky film of bacteria and enamel eroding acids which cling to the surfaces of your teeth and gums. Brushing and flossing can remove most, but certainly not all plaque, especially around your gum line. The bacteria in plaque deteriorate gums and supporting tissues over time. In fact, plaque that is not completely removed within 48 hours can harden into a rough deposit called tartar which can only be removed with a professional dental cleaning.

Do You Have Periodontal Disease?

  • Chronic bad breath
  • Red, swollen, or sensitive gums
  • Bleeding gums
  • Painful chewing
  • Loosened or shifting teeth
  • Receding gums or elongated teeth

How is Periodontal Disease Treated?

If you have periodontal disease, the first treatment step will include comprehensive scaling and root planing to disinfect and smooth out periodontal pockets. Scaling removes plaque and tartar from deep below the gum line to keep bacteria from accumulating again.

Do You Have Sleep Apnea?

Although not everyone who snores has sleep apnea, the most common sign of sleep apnea is loud, incessant snoring, followed by pauses and choking or gasping sounds. The snoring is usually the loudest when you sleep on your back. Family members are often the first to notice these issues. You may not even be aware of the problems until a loved one points them out. Another common sign of sleep apnea is fighting sleepiness during the day, or being unable to focus or concentrate. You may also find yourself rapidly falling asleep during the quiet moments.

What Are Your Sleep Apnea Therapy Options?

  • CPAP (continuous positive airway pressure): CPAP is the most common treatment for sleep apnea in adults. CPAP uses a small face mask and a machine that gently blows air into your throat as you sleep. The pressure from the air helps keep your airway open. However CPAP treatment is not well tolerated by everyone. CPAP may cause side effects like stuffy nose, irritated skin, dry mouth, stomach bloating, and headaches.
  • Oral Appliance Therapy: For those who wish to avoid CPAP, Dr. Davey offers oral appliance therapy for sleep apnea relief.  An oral appliance is a custom-fitted plastic mouthpiece. The mouthpiece can be worn during sleep to adjust your lower jaw and tongue. This will keep your airways open while you sleep to gently relive your sleep apnea symptoms.
